Which delivery condition is a valid reason to REJECT a shipment of fresh produce and packaged foods?

a.Produce that is properly cold and crisp
b.A sealed, undamaged bag of flour
c.Torn or water-stained packaging, evidence of pests (droppings/gnaw marks), or off odors
d.Cases stacked neatly on a clean pallet

Explanation

Deliveries must be rejected when packaging is torn, punctured, or water-stained, when there is evidence of pests such as droppings or gnaw marks, or when there are off odors, slime, or mold, because these indicate contamination or abuse. Neatly stacked cases, properly cold produce, and sealed undamaged bags are all acceptable. The receiving inspection is a key control before food enters storage.

Law Reference: FDA Food Code §3-202.15
